The larger of two numbers is 1 less than 3 times the smaller number. If twice the smaller number is increased by the larger number, the result is 18 more than the larger number.Find both numbers

If the two numbers are x and y, then

y = 3x-1
2x+y = y+18

Now just solve for x and y
